Removing screw elements from splined shafts


Removing segmented screw elements from a splined shaft is not always easy, since polymer can creep between adjacent elements and degrade into an adhesive. The following is a basic removal method:


1. Work on the screws immediately after cleaning and while still hot.
2. Clamp one screw in a bench vise so it is horizontal with the screw tip end near the vise (brass or aluminum jaws).
3. Unscrew the tip, if the screw element doesn't slide off use a propane torch to heat the element and try again. If it still doesn't move you will need a brass drift punch and hammer to apply impact force.
4. As you remove each element brush/clean the exposed shaft to make it easier to remove subsequent elements.
5. Consider removing elements from the shafts on a regular schedule as part of your preventative maintenance program.
